The relationship between thyroid hormone and muscle mass in ambulatory, euthyroid … WebApr 30, 2024 · The lymph nodes are part of the lymphatic system, an important element in our body’s immune system. The lymphatic system collects fluid that is outside of the bloodstream throughout the body. This clear fluid, known as lymph, can contain waste materials, bacteria, and viruses. WebIn an atonic seizure, the person's body will suddenly become limp. If sitting, their head or upper body may slump over. If standing, the person many fall limply to the ground. Since the muscles are weak or limp, the person falls like a rag doll. When a person’s muscles are stiff or rigid, they will fall like a tree trunk.
